China win gold in men's synchronised 3m springboard

China's Luo Yutong and Kai Qin have won the gold medal in the men's synchronised 3m springboard at London 2012.

The duo remained in the lead throughout the competition, and distanced themselves from the pack in the fifth round, earning a score of 104.88 for a forward four-and-a-half somersault.

Luo and Kai finished in first place with a final score of 477.00, followed by Russia's Ilya Zakharov and Evgeny Kuznetsov, who were locked in a three-way battle with the US and the Ukraine for silver and bronze.

Troy Dumais and Kristian Ipsen of the United States showed perseverance and consistency to earn the bronze, pushing Ukrainian pair Oleksiy Prygorov and Illya Kvasha into fourth.

Team GB pair Chris Mears and Nicholas Robinson-Baker, who only qualified for London 2012 because Britain is the host nation, came an admirable fifth.
